Career Roles in Environmental Storytelling Environmental Educators: Engage communities through storytelling to raise awareness about environmental issues and promote sustainable practices.
Sustainability Consultants: Advise organizations on best practices in sustainability, utilizing storytelling to communicate strategies and engage stakeholders.
Policy Analysts: Analyze environmental policies and advocate for sustainable development through effective communication and narrative techniques.
Content Creators: Develop engaging content that highlights environmental challenges and solutions, using storytelling to inspire action.
Wildlife Managers: Manage natural resources and wildlife through community engagement and storytelling to promote biodiversity conservation.
Community Organizers: Mobilize communities to take action on sustainability issues, using storytelling to connect and empower individuals.
Researchers: Conduct studies related to environmental storytelling, focusing on its impact on sustainable development and public engagement.
